Join Dr. Adam Gries, DACM, L.AC. and Laura Gries, Health & Spiritual Coach on their weekly podcast where they discuss how to navigate life's highs, lows, and everything in between. As professional spiritual and life coaches, they offer a holistic approach to finding peace and happiness using ancient wisdom. They cover topics such as setting good boundaries, love, marriage, raising children, finding your purpose, and more.
